The Erne District Chinese Families' and Friends' Association

The Erne District Chinese Families' and Friends' Association is a registered charity in Northern Ireland working in the advancement of the arts, culture, heritage or science, based in Enniskillen.

What the charity does

AIMS The aims of the Association are to promote Chinese culture, language and traditions, to ensure future generations are aware of their heritage, to celebrate Chinese festivals with other residents in the locality and to have a point of contact for members of the Chinese community wishing to express their concerns with any matters affecting Chinese people.
